At 1100 PM CDT, Doppler radar and automated rain gauges indicated that thunderstorms were moving out of the area and rain rates were decreasing. Up to 3 inches of rain occurred between Lee Center and Ashton due to earlier storms.
HAZARD...Flash flooding caused by thunderstorms.
SOURCE...Radar and automated gauges.
IMPACT...Rapid-onset flooding of creeks, streams, drainage ditches, streets, underpasses, low-lying areas, and other poor drainage areas.
Some locations that will experience flash flooding include... Amboy, Franklin Grove, Paw Paw, Lee, Compton, Steward, West Brooklyn and Lee Center.
